Scottish golfer Robert McIntyre was in desperate need of an emergency caddy heading into the RBC Canadian open his choice his dad I just can’t believe this has happened to be honest with you Robert had rotated through a few caddies since parting ways with his most recent one after missing the cut at the Charles Schwab he said out to find a new bagman but when request kept falling through he turned to the man who taught him the game despite not having any caddy experience douge McIntyre was by his son’s side to experience his first win on the PJ tour a win that earned Robert over1 million do in the process McIntyre headed into the final day with a four shot lead but needed a pep talk from his dad after an opening hole Bogey and a three birdie surge by Local Hero McKenzie Hughes tears were flowing after the final round and Robert McIntyre did not hold back when talking about how much it meant for him to have his father by his side that means everything been a journey that we’ve all been on as for douge who is the head groundskeeper at Glen Crouton Country Club he set to resume his duties cutting grass and noin after celebrating this Victory with his son
